Course details

• Biophilic Design Principles for Constrained Spaces
• Maximizing Natural Light in Tiny Dining Areas
• Material Selection: Natural Textures and Finishes
• Integrating Greenery and Vertical Gardens
• Enhancing Air Quality and Ventilation
• Biomimicry in Tiny Dining Design
• Sensory Stimulation: Sight, Sound, and Smell
• Space Planning for Optimal Flow and Functionality
•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Materials
• Case Studies of Successful Biophilic Tiny Dining Designs

Career path

Career Role Description
Biophilic Design Consultant (Tiny Spaces) Specializes in integrating nature into compact dining areas, maximizing space efficiency and wellbeing. High demand for sustainable and innovative solutions.
Interior Architect (Biophilic Tiny Dining) Designs and implements biophilic principles in the architecture and interior design of small-scale dining establishments, focusing on spatial optimization and natural elements.
Landscape Architect (Biophilic Micro-Dining) Creates miniature green spaces and outdoor dining areas, incorporating biophilic design to enhance the dining experience in limited spaces. Growing sector with significant potential.
Sustainable Tiny Restaurant Designer Focuses on eco-friendly and biophilic design elements in compact restaurants, considering environmental impact and user experience within small footprints.
